About Queen Of All Saints
-
Queen Of All Saints is located in Brooklyn, NY. It is a private school that serves 252 students in grades K-8. Queen Of All Saints is coed (school has male and female students) and is Roman Catholic in orientation.
In 2008, Queen Of All Saints had 24 students for every full-time equivalent teacher. The New York average is 13 students per full-time equivalent teacher. Learn more about Queen Of All Saints's students and teachers.
